Problème d'utilisation des fonctions récursives sur tp3.2, aidez-moi s'il vous plaît
phpcn_u1546
phpcn_u1546 2017-08-27 16:22:13
0
1
1091

111.png222.png

Le côté gauche de l'image est le code et le côté droit est le résultat de l'exécution. J'exécute la fonction aaa(), qui exécute la fonction kissom() trois fois, mais pourquoi les résultats sont-ils imprimés les deuxième et troisième fois, et il n'y a qu'une seule ligne. Cela devrait être un problème statique lors de l'exécution de la deuxième ? et la troisième fois, le nombre de $ est mis à jour. Mais cette fonction peut être exécutée si elle n'est pas placée dans tp, mais ne peut pas être exécutée dans le framework tp. Y a-t-il quelqu'un qui peut me donner des conseils ?

phpcn_u1546
phpcn_u1546

répondre à tous(1)
phpcn_u1546

Modifiez-le, j'ai changé la condition if ci-dessus en $count<5, je l'ai oublié. Existe-t-il un grand dieu

  • répondre Après avoir exécuté kissom pour la première fois dans la méthode aaa, $count est finalement égal à 4. Étant donné que votre condition if est <5, elle ne s'exécutera pas si elle est égale à 5, donc les deux appels suivants sont tous deux 5.
    ringa_lee auteur 2017-08-27 22:41:38
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al